Prediction: Nantes vs. Lorient – Ligue 1 – 23rd September 2023
Nantes welcomes Lorient in what promises to be a tightly contested Ligue 1 fixture at the Stade de la Beaujoire on Saturday, 23rd September 2023. Both sides aim to build on their recent results, with Nantes fresh off their first win and Lorient buoyed by a commendable draw against league leaders, Monaco.
Analysis:
Nantes: Despite a noteworthy run in the UEFA Europa League last season and clinching the 2022 Coupe de France, Nantes barely escaped relegation, and that pattern of struggling seems to continue this season. Beginning their 2023-24 campaign on the back foot with losses against Toulouse and Lille, Pierre Aristouy’s men have now put together a three-match unbeaten run. Key player Mostafa Mohamed, after a dazzling performance against Monaco, continued his form against Marseille. Nantes showcased their resilience by playing with 10 men for almost the entire match following Bastien Meupiyou’s early dismissal, holding Marseille to a 1-1 draw. Their recent 1-0 win over Clermont, with Moses Simon netting the only goal, will give them confidence heading into this weekend’s game.
Lorient: Promoted to Ligue 1 just a few seasons ago, Lorient has maintained a commendable mid-table presence. Last season saw them finish in the top half, and under Regis Le Bris’s management, they will be eyeing a place in the European spots this time around. The team managed to hold PSG to a goalless draw despite being bombarded with shots, a testament to their defensive capabilities. Their recent 2-2 draw against Monaco, thanks to Romain Faivre’s last-minute equalizer, signals that the side is steadily progressing.
Team News: Nantes have injury woes to consider with the absence of Fabien Centonze and young prospect Nathan Zeze. Their most significant setback is the injury of their goalkeeper Alban Lafont, requiring Remy Descamps to take his place. Pierre Aristouy might opt for a 4-2-3-1 formation, with Ignatius Ganago leading the attack.
Lorient, in contrast, has a more extensive list of injuries. Key players like Tiemoue Bakayoko and Jean-Victor Makengo remain sidelined. Regis Le Bris will likely field his team in a 3-4-2-1 formation, with Eli Junior Kroupi as the focal point of the attack.
Prediction:
Given the current form and the recent results, Nantes has momentum on their side, especially with their morale-boosting victory against Clermont. Lorient, however, has shown resilience, especially in their draws against PSG and Monaco. With both sides having a closely matched recent record, this encounter promises to be a nail-biter.
Goal.mu predicts: Nantes 1-1 Lorient.
Both teams seem evenly matched, with Nantes having the home advantage but Lorient proving tough to beat on their travels. The injuries on both sides might offset each other, leading to a well-fought draw.
